广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> app公众号开发教程

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

app公众号开发教程

时间:2025-01-24 00:05:00来源:红匣子科技阅读:250124
App公众号开发教程在移动互联网时代,App公众号作为一种新兴的微信公众号形式,能够为用户提供更为便捷的服务和更完整的用户体验。本文将详细介绍App公众号的开发流程及其相关技术要点,帮助开发者快速上手。1. App公众号的概念App公众号是指在移动应用程序内部嵌入的微信公众号,它可以实现与应用的无缝

App公众号开发教程在移动互联网时代,App公众号作为一种新兴的微信公众号形式,能够为用户提供更为便捷的服务和更完整的用户体验。本文将详细介绍App公众号的开发流程及其相关技术要点,帮助开发者快速上手。

1. App公众号的概念

App公众号是指在移动应用程序内部嵌入的微信公众号,它可以实现与应用的无缝衔接。与传统的微信公众号相比,App公众号能够提供更为定制化的功能,适应多种场景下的应用需求。开发者可以通过微信开放平台提供的接口,实现消息接收、事件处理、自定义菜单等功能。

2. 开发环境搭建

在开始开发之前,开发者需要搭建一个合适的开发环境。以下是基本步骤:

  • 注册公众号:首先,开发者需要在微信公众平台注册一个公众号,选择“服务号”或“订阅号”,并完成身份认证。

  • 搭建本地调试环境:使用工具如natapp进行内网穿透,确保能够在本地测试公众号的功能。开发者需要下载natapp客户端,并配置相应的域名和token。

  • 获取access_token:通过发送请求获取access_token,这是调用微信API的凭证,开发者需要妥善管理。

3. 核心功能实现

App公众号的核心功能主要包括以下几个方面:

  • 消息接收与推送:开发者需要实现消息和事件的接收与推送,确保能够及时响应用户的请求。

  • 自定义菜单:通过微信公众平台的接口,开发者可以创建自定义菜单,提升用户体验。

  • 用户管理:开发者可以通过API获取用户信息,管理用户标签,进行精准营销。

4. 开发流程

以下是App公众号开发的基本流程:

  1. 接口配置:在微信公众平台上配置接口地址,确保能够接收来自微信服务器的请求。

  2. 编写后端代码:使用语言如Java、Python等编写后端代码,处理接收到的消息和事件。

  3. 测试与调试:通过natapp等工具进行测试,确保所有功能正常运行。

  4. 上线与维护:完成开发后,将应用上线,并定期进行维护和更新。

5. 深度扩展

在完成基本功能后,开发者可以考虑以下深度扩展策略:

  • 数据分析:通过收集用户在公众号中的行为数据,开发者可以进行数据分析,优化应用和营销策略。

  • 用户互动:增加互动功能,如投票、问卷调查等,提升用户参与感和粘性。

  • 内容优化:定期更新高质量的内容,吸引用户关注和分享,提升公众号的影响力。

  • 多渠道推广:结合社交媒体、线下活动等多种渠道进行推广,扩大用户基础。

6.结论

App公众号的开发不仅能够提升用户体验,还能为企业带来更多的商业机会。通过合理的开发流程和深度的功能扩展,开发者可以充分利用这一平台,实现更高的用户满意度和品牌认知度。随着技术的不断进步,App公众号的潜力将会进一步释放,成为企业数字化转型的重要工具。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:app充电计时器开发

下一篇:app判断开发商水平

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询